Why choose synthetic turf
The introduction of synthetic turf in training areas stems from the need to create surfaces dedicated to dynamic exercises that require high resistance to wear. In particular, sled workouts, sprints, and changes of direction put any traditional covering under stress.
A specific surface allows for improving the quality of training by offering greater grip, a more natural sensation during pushing, and better perception of the spaces dedicated to athletic activities.
From a commercial point of view, the presence of a green lane also represents a distinctive element that contributes to enhancing photographs, promotional videos, and social media content of the gym.
An ideal solution for functional training
Functional areas require materials designed to withstand continuous use, multi-directional movements, and heavy equipment. A modern functional training floor with the insertion of synthetic turf allows for clearly separating different operational zones, increasing safety and organization.
The perfect lane for the sled
The creation of a gym sled lane allows for performing pushing and pulling exercises while reducing the wear of traditional flooring and improving the fluidity of movement.
Functional advantages
One of the main benefits of synthetic turf consists of its ability to withstand intensive use while maintaining a professional appearance over time. High-density fibers are designed to withstand the continuous passage of users and equipment.
The surface guarantees a good balance between friction and smoothness, a fundamental characteristic during exercises with sleds and weighted sleds.
Furthermore, it facilitates the subdivision of spaces, allowing for the creation of dedicated paths without complex structural interventions.
Greater safety
A uniform surface helps to reduce the risk of tripping and improves stability during explosive exercises.
Resistance over time
Professional products maintain color and technical characteristics even after years of intense use, reducing replacement interventions.

How to install it correctly
Correct installation starts with the preparation of the subfloor. The surface must be perfectly leveled and clean to ensure uniform adhesion.
It is important to use specific glues and professional products capable of withstanding strong mechanical stresses.
The positioning must also consider the maneuvering spaces for equipment and the flow of users within the gym.
Sizing
The length of the lane generally varies between 10 and 20 meters depending on the available space and the planned activities.
Maintenance
Simple periodic cleaning allows for maintaining high aesthetic and functional performance without particular operating costs.
How to choose the best product
Not all synthetic surfaces are the same. Professional solutions use high-resistance fibers, reinforced backings, and adhesives designed for intensive use.
It is important to evaluate density, fiber height, elastic recovery capacity, and compatibility with the planned exercises.
Relying on suppliers specialized in the fitness sector allows for obtaining a solution truly designed for the needs of gyms.
Professional materials
Higher construction quality guarantees superior durability and better performance in the long term.

Errors to avoid
One of the most frequent errors consists of purchasing products intended for residential use. These materials are not designed to support continuous loads and tend to deteriorate rapidly.
Even an improvised installation can compromise the durability of the surface, causing detachment or deformations.
Finally, it is fundamental to carefully evaluate the position of the lane to avoid interference with other training areas.
Saving on material
A choice exclusively oriented towards price often entails higher costs in the medium term due to early replacements.
Neglecting design
Accurate planning improves the user experience and optimizes the use of available spaces.
